Use "incisive" in a sentence | "incisive" example sentences

How to use "incisive" in a sentence?

  • Unless we believe in the hero, what is there To believe? Incisive what, the fellow Of what good. Devise. Make him of mud.
    -Wallace Stevens-
  • A man who's active and incisive can yet keep nail-care much in mind: why fight what's known to be decisive? Custom is despot of mankind.
    -Alexander Pushkin-
  • Her eyes were olive green―incisive and clear.
    -Dan Brown-
  • It is difficult to produce a television documentary that is both incisive and probing when every twelve minutes one is interrupted by twelve dancing rabbits singing about toilet paper.
    -Rod Serling-

Definition and meaning of INCISIVE

What does "incisive mean?"

/inˈsīsiv/

incisive

adjective
intelligently analytical and clear-thinking.

What are synonyms of "incisive"?
Some common synonyms of "incisive" are:
  • penetrating,
  • acute,
  • sharp,
  • sharp-witted,
  • razor-sharp,
  • keen,
  • rapierlike,
  • astute,
  • shrewd,
  • trenchant,
  • piercing,
  • perceptive,
  • insightful,
  • percipient,
  • perspicacious,
